Randolph County, GA (Georgia) voted D+7.6 for Kamala Harris (Democrat) in the 2024 presidential election, with Harris receiving 1,601 votes (53.33%) to 1,373 (45.74%) for Trump.

This represents a R+1.5% swing toward Republicans compared to 2020. Randolph County is classified as a lean Democratic county. Randolph County has voted Democratic in every presidential election since 1988. The county has a population of approximately 6,196.
